Hayfield Cheerleading Squad Takes 1st Place in Competition

Squad ranks in top four at national district cheerleading championship.

Hawks Secondary School's cheerleading squad took first place last month in the AAA National District Cheerleading Championship.

Hayfield came in first with a score of 245; Falls Church came in second with a score of 239; Mount Vernon came in third with a score of 219 and Washington-Lee came in fourth with a score of 211.5.

Other schools competing included JEB Stuart, Edison, Wakefield and Yorktown.

Regional semi-finals were Saturday, Oct. 29 at Fairfax High School.  No teams from National District moved on to regional finals which is this Saturday, Nov. 5 at Fairfax.
